Renovated George School history building opens

Posted: 06 Sep 2010 02:43 PM PDT

Newtown — George School students will learn history in seven new, high-tech, and eco-friendly classrooms when the renovated McFeely building opens for classes on the first day of school, Monday, Aug. 30, 2010. A seven-month green renovation has transformed the McFeely building, once the school's library, into the home of the history department. Each of its new classrooms has natural daylight ...
